BEAPI - Maintenance Mode
Puts your WordPress site into maintenance mode by sending a 'Error 503: Access Denied/Forbidden' status to all unauthenticated clients.

AI summary of the plugin's readmeThis plugin is for WordPress site administrators and developers who need to take a site offline temporarily, including multisite setups. It puts the site into maintenance mode by returning a 503 status to unauthenticated visitors, preserving SEO rankings while still allowing logged-in users and login/logout to function normally.
- No configuration options needed
- Sends 503 Service Unavailable status
- Preserves SEO during maintenance
- Login/logout process still works
- Multisite activation support
- IP whitelist via filter
- Customizable maintenance mode template
- Composer activation command
